File git-delta.changes of Package git-delta
------------------------------------------------------------------- Mon Aug 10 06:03:45 UTC 2020 - Martin Sirringhaus <martin.sirringhaus@suse.com> - Update to version 0.4.1 * This release fixes a few bugs. In particular, it makes it possible to use git add -p with line numbers activated. If you also have side-by-side activated then that will not be used in git add -p (it's impossible) but it will now not cause an error either. - Dockerfile isn't colored - [Linux] git add -p not working with side-by-side - Mismatch in line numbers between git diff and git add -p ------------------------------------------------------------------- Wed Aug 5 09:52:32 UTC 2020 - Martin Sirringhaus <martin.sirringhaus@suse.com> - Update to version 0.4 * The main new feature in this release is support for git diff --color-moved. This makes Git's native moved-line detection algorithms and styling options available when using Delta. Delta supports this automatically, without any configuration change, but see the new option inspect-raw-lines in case you need to turn it off. * The other new feature is that Delta can now cause files and commit hashes to be rendered as hyperlinks in your terminal emulator: However, this will not be available to you without, at the minimum, installing a patched version of less, because support for the hyperlink spec has only partially spread through the terminal application ecosystem. See delta --help text for details. * Bugs fixed: * Support --color-moved * Support --color-moved-ws * Support displaying files and commits as OSC 8 hyperlinks * width option is not honored in git config sections * diff -U0 rendered with lines out of order * paging should be supported in gitconfig * syntax-theme should be honored in a custom feature in gitconfig * Line numbers style not taking effect with --side-by-side * Duplicate "renamed" header when file is renamed with changes ------------------------------------------------------------------- Thu Jul 16 09:09:02 UTC 2020 - Martin Sirringhaus <martin.sirringhaus@suse.com> - Update to version 0.3 * This release adds a side-by-side diff view: delta -s or delta --side-by-side. By default, side-by-side view has line-numbers activated, and has syntax highlighting in both the left and right panels. * The release also fixes bug #238 in which the line number display alignment was broken for line numbers greater than 9999. - Update to version 0.2 This is a large release, introducing major changes to delta configuration as well as new features and bug fixes. It involved a major overhaul of the code base. The highlights are: * To configure delta's appearance, you now use "styles" instead of background color names. A style is a string like red bold ul "#ffeeee" that specifies foreground color, background color, and attributes. See https://github.com/dandavison/delta#choosing-colors-styles. * Delta now reads configuration from a [delta] section in git config, and this is the recommended way to configure delta. See https://github.com/dandavison/delta#configuration * Delta now has a line numbers feature. * Delta now has --diff-highlight and --diff-so-fancy emulation modes ------------------------------------------------------------------- Tue Apr 28 07:58:02 UTC 2020 - Martin Sirringhaus <martin.sirringhaus@suse.com> - Initial commit of version 0.1.1
